This 5-day online course covers the basics of designing, simulating and, analyzing automotive lighting system optics using LucidShape.
It assumes familiarity with optics concepts and terminology.
• Design the optics for simple automotive lighting systems
• Simulate complex automotive lighting systems
• Evaluate a system to determine its performance and use industry-standard test tables to confirm regulation conformity

LucidShape is a powerful 3D software for computer-aided design, simulation and analysis of illumination optical systems, primarily used for automotive lighting applications. Its strengths are that it is the fastest and easiest software to design today’s faceted segmented reflectors and lenses for lighting applications.
LucidShape CAA V5 Based is an interactive development environment for optical simulation and analysis integrated into the CATIA V5 platform, available for CATIA V5 R24, R25, and R26.
LucidDrive is a standalone night driving simulation tool for evaluation of vehicle headlamp beam patterns under simulated, realistic conditions prior to expensive fabrication and hardware testing.
